What is Cosmetology<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"estheticsCosmetology is an occupation that is everything about making the human anatomy look more beautiful with the application of cosmetics. So of course it makes sense that a number of cosmetology schools are described as beauty schools. Many of us think of makeup when we hear the word cosmetics, but really a cosmetic may be almost anything that improves the look of a person’s skin, hair or nails. If you want to work as a cosmetologist, almost all states mandate that you undergo some form of specialized training and then be licensed. Once licensed, the work settings include not only Kingston MI beauty salons and barber shops, but also such businesses as spas, hotels and resorts. Many cosmetologists, after they have acquired experience and a client base, open their own shops or salons. Others will begin servicing clients either in their own homes or will travel to the client’s home, or both.
